Subject: RE: DOCBOOK: Problem with TeX jade output.


Nik,
	Well, I found the solution to the underline problem.... for some reason the
dvi reader was causing it, because when I installed the dvi reader from the
ports collection (xdvi) it worked fine.  It's strange because I was using
xdvi before (it must have been bundled with X), and the one in the ports
installed right over the top.

	This solves half of my complete problem.  From DVI, I wanted to be able to
convert it to PS, but when I try to run dvips on it, I get:
